Emerging Specializations
The realm of management is seeing rising demands for unique expertise and specializations. Certain rooms which include data analytics, sustainability management, digital marketing and artificial intelligence are advancing the frontiers and generating bright futures for upcoming professionals. Data science positions, including Data Detectives, have been on a remarkable growth of around 42%, indicating the value of data literacy in the digital age. Secondly, sustainability management is becoming a major trend within business, as companies shift towards green business-oriented practices and achievable sustainability goals to satisfy consumer preferences and protection policies.
Remote Work Opportunities
The management sector was affected by the pandemic. The new age of remote working has introduced unprecedented flexibility to the field of management, bringing about the need for a new set of digital collaboration skills. The ever-increasing popularity of remote-based managerial jobs, as well as the posted updates on platforms such as LinkedIn, suggest the workplace is becoming increasingly flexible in terms of location. A crucial set of skills – the ability to utilize digital tools for collaboration and an understanding of flexible work policies – allow professionals to manage and work from a distance seamlessly.

Globalization and International Roles
Globalization expanded opportunities for management professionals and made them work outside their country which in turn helps them have a deep understanding. Those professionals with international experience and intercultural skills are quite in high demand. A couple of high demands include:
- International Business Management: This specialisation includes managing international organizations, making trade agreements, and handling global teams.
- Cross-Border Management: by creating cross-country teams and projects that also work simultaneously, communication needs to be an ace and flexibility needs to be at its peak.
- Global Supply Chain Management: Ensuring the smooth flow of services and goods between international borderlands is crucial for companies in the current global economy.
Continuous Learning and Upskilling
Professionals should learn the latest techniques, tools, and methodologies to be competitive. The mindset of growth, taking certifications, like Certified ScrumMaster and Certified Information Security Manager, and attending workshops are crucial to gaining a job in the industry in modern times. Moreover, one may access the best courses and training through Coursera, an online learning platform, where professionals may take courses at any pace and time to match their schedule. The ability to develop becomes more crucial these days since it is one’s continuing career instead of a one-time event.
Sustainability Studies and Environmental Management
Environmental management and sustainability studies are fast becoming the cornerstones of management in the near future. Businesses are no longer only concerned with profit margins, but they are increasingly under pressure from governments, consumers, and environmental groups to act in a manner that safeguards the environment. This is a great chance for managers who can develop as well as implement sustainability practices within an organization.
Imagine being the CEO who is in charge of a company's transition towards renewable energy sources, or creating a closed-loop supply chain that eliminates the amount of waste. Sustainability-focused managers can not only make a positive impact on the environment, but also improve a company's brand reputation, attract top talent, and potentially gain a competitive advantage. This isn't just concerned with environmental science. It's about understanding how to incorporate sustainability into all aspects of business decisions, making it a truly unique and rewarding career choice.
